Earlier this season, Pittsburgh Steelers wide receiver George Pickens made headlines with an inadvertent shot at Lions pass catcher Amon-Ra St. Brown.

The Detroit star hasn’t forgotten the slander. This week, he unveiled a new merchandise line featuring Pickens’ disrespectful words. He’s chosen to profit off of the shade.

In mid-October, Pickens appeared on FS1’s The Facility. He was asked his opinion on NFL receiver rankings, and where he believes he’s positioned in that group. Pickens emphatically stated that he was Top 5 before taking a jab at St. Brown.

He called St. Brown a “slot merchant” that gets “fed the ball” by the Detroit Lions. Pickens believes that those targets inflate the numbers of St. Brown and other wideouts who consistently play on the inside as opposed to out wide.

That offensive trend continued throughout the 2024 season with St. Brown hauling in 115 catches to lead the team. Pickens, meanwhile, recorded 59 catches for 900 yards.

Both players wrapped up their regular seasons on Sunday, though with largely different results. Detroit secured the No. 1 seed in the NFC with a dismantling of the Minnesota Vikings. Pittsburgh fell to the Bengals, missing out on a chance to land the top wildcard slot in the AFC.

Amon-Ra St. Brown celebrated that successful campaign with a merchandise release this week. He dropped a new line of “Slot Merchant” gear available for purchase on his online store.

St. Brown didn’t forget about the shade. He’ll profit off of it after another productive season.
